Trend To Try With Caution: Embroidered Denim

Now that I really look at this image I realize the embroidered denim trend might be pushing the limits of what is appropriate for women over 40 to wear. However, like most other trends, it’s not just how you wear it, but how much of it you wear. I can’t stress enough that unless you want to look like you just came back from Coachella (which in my opinion is not very cool when you are in your forties and beyond) WEAR ONE EMBROIDERED DENIM ITEM AT A TIME! Yes, I purposely typed that in all bold because I really mean it.

Chain Of Command – Chain Link Bags

Good Lord. It is so hard to keep up with all the handbag trends this season, but one that is back in a BIG way is an oldie, but a goodie: the chain link bag. If you already have a Chanel bag you are in luck. If you don’t and can’t quite afford one or want to spend the money, or if you are just looking to add another to your chain posse, there are some phenomenal options at virtually every price point.

Tiny Totes

If the the thought of spending $3,000+ on a designer bag seems frivolous to you, or simply out of your range, the hot bag trend of the moment is the miniature version of your favorite designer bags. As long as you don’t need to carry a ton of things (it never looks good to have your bag look overstuffed) or just want to use it for evening many of these nano or doll-size versions of popular handbags come in at well under $2,000.

Wearable Trends: Transition To Spring In Suede

It’s time to cast aside the fashion taboo that leather and suede is only for the winter months. Suede has made a major comeback and not in the heavy weight 1960s and 70s hippie way. Suede has been re-imagined for today’s modern woman (and man!) and is now soft, buttery, lightweight and ideal for transitioning into the warmer weather months.
